[googlead]If you are not aware of HouseBot by CeBotics, it’s an affordable HA controller application for Windows that allows you to monitor and control lights, appliances, A/V equipment and much more using customizable graphic interfaces for PCs, touchscreens, and wireless PDAs. HouseBot includes an intuitive task scripting engine where tasks are created using a point-and-click wizard for sophisticated events without manual programming.
xAP Plugins for HouseBot by ersp-design is new software that lets HouseBot work with any xAP-enabled device on a home automation network. xAP-enabled HouseBot installations can work with audio servers such as SqueezeCenter;
lighting systems including C-Bus, Dynalite and DMX; 1-Wire temperature/weather monitoring; caller ID etc.
xAP can also be used to integrate HouseBot with other home automation platforms such as HomeSeer and Comfort providing user interfaces that can look as good as those from high-end manufacturers for a fraction of the
price.

All these are fully compatible with other HouseBot devices. They can be scripted, used in triggers and tasks as well as working with HouseBot’s graphical remote control development tools.
HouseBot can be evaluated free for 30 days (visit www.housebot.com) and costs just $69US for a full licence. The xAP plugin can be used in trial mode with a limited number of devices for any period; an unlimited version costs just $10US. Visit www.erspearson.com/xAP/HouseBot.
